UnpicklingError when loading a trained model

I have been trying to load a trained model.

This is my code block

import torch
from torch.serialization import add_safe_globals
import numpy as np

# If PyTorch complains about missing globals:
add_safe_globals([np.core.multiarray._reconstruct])
state_dict = torch.load("best.pt", weights_only=True, map_location="cpu")

I am getting below error message.

UnpicklingError: Weights only load failed. This file can still be loaded, to do so you have two options, do those steps only if you trust the source of the checkpoint. 
	(1) In PyTorch 2.6, we changed the default value of the `weights_only` argument in `torch.load` from `False` to `True`. Re-running `torch.load` with `weights_only` set to `False` will likely succeed, but it can result in arbitrary code execution. Do it only if you got the file from a trusted source.
	(2) Alternatively, to load with `weights_only=True` please check the recommended steps in the following error message.
	WeightsUnpickler error: Unsupported global: GLOBAL numpy.core.multiarray._reconstruct was not an allowed global by default. Please use `torch.serialization.add_safe_globals([numpy.core.multiarray._reconstruct])` or the `torch.serialization.safe_globals([numpy.core.multiarray._reconstruct])` context manager to allowlist this global if you trust this class/function.
